Numbering Way 1The first way is to have the number follow one another on the map (as it is currently), this makes it easier to find the lairs since user immediately know where approximately to look. But would make the list under the map quite fragmented.
Numbering Way 2The second way is to label the lairs by type, so warg lairs on this map will all be numbered one, wildmen lairs will all be numbered two, ect... This makes the list much shorter but can make the differentiating of lairs on the map complicated, since they can no longer be referred by individual numbers.
Numbering Way 3The third way is to have the lairs be part of a range of numbers, so let's say all wildmen lair will be numbered 1-6,all warg lairs 7-10 and all cave troll lairs 11&12. This would make the bottom list more organized but would create a certain discontinuity in the way the map is numbered with number placement seeming to have no logic.
